Personnel Parachute Static Line
1670016234092 016234092 830245-0
A static line, the tension in which initiates a deployment sequence due to the relative motion of the two bodies, one of which contains a PARACHUTE, PERSONNEL (as modified). The other body is commonly the static cable or strong point on an aircraft. View more Personnel Parachute Static Line
